US aviation big Boeing has instructed BBC Information it’s donating $1m (£812,600) to an inauguration fund for President-elect Donald Trump.

Google has additionally confirmed that it has made the same donation as the 2 corporations be a part of a rising record of main American corporations contributing to the fund.

The record additionally consists of oil producer Chevron and know-how giants Meta, Amazon and Uber.

Trump’s inauguration, marking the beginning of his second time period within the White Home, is ready to happen on 20 January.

“We’re happy to proceed Boeing’s bipartisan custom of supporting US Presidential Inaugural Committees,” Boeing stated.

The corporate added that it has made related donations to every of the previous three presidential inauguration funds.

Boeing is working to get better from a security and high quality management disaster, in addition to coping with the losses from a strike final 12 months.

The corporate can be constructing the following presidential plane, generally known as Air Drive One. The 2 jets are anticipated to return into service as early as subsequent 12 months.

Throughout his first time period as president, Trump pressured the aircraft maker to renegotiate its contract, calling the preliminary deal too costly.

Google grew to become the newest large tech agency to donate to the fund, following related bulletins by Meta and Amazon. It additionally stated it’s going to stream the occasion all over the world.

“Google is happy to help the 2025 inauguration, with a livestream on YouTube and a direct hyperlink on our homepage,” stated Karan Bhatia, Google’s international head of presidency affairs and public coverage.

Automobile corporations Ford, Basic Motors and Toyota have additionally donated a $1m every to the inaugural committee.

Within the vitality trade, Chevron confirmed that it has made a donation to the fund however declined to say how a lot.

“Chevron has a protracted custom of celebrating democracy by supporting the inaugural committees of each events. We’re proud to be doing so once more this 12 months,” stated Invoice Turene, Chevron’s supervisor of world media relations.
